  3. Hace 3 días · Red, a color linked to energy, passion, and urgency, is a powerful tool in branding. It increases heart rate and creates excitement, making it ideal for attracting attention and eliciting strong emotional responses. Brands like Coca-Cola and Red Bull use red to evoke a sense of bold energy, appealing especially to young, enthusiastic consumers.
